I personally would swap the looms over. The time it will take you to successfully integrate the two looms far outweighs the hour or two to strip the necessary trim panels inside and the dash (10-15 minute job for the dash) and pull the loom into the engine bay and refit accordingly.
have known people to cut the XR loom just by the pillar and join the Rs looms together believe it to be 6 wires to join (cant remember exactly) but when I did it I changed the whole loom as car was all stripped out!
